Output d954611754a6698252c340052af1a8e91100de59b8e5c9221bb32e5f58b98c21:0

value
3044739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d03cd97989bd0988cf4a219f428a2ea98c8de17 OP_EQUAL
address
37FdhVKPhwK9FxF4yzLYNrXkY1RuNbn5rX
transaction
d954611754a6698252c340052af1a8e91100de59b8e5c9221bb32e5f58b98c21
spent
true